Ingredients

- Krill oil 590mg - Omega-3 fatty acids 159mg - Eicosapentaenoic acid 89mg - Docosahexaenoic acid 41mg - Phospholipids 330mg - Choline 41.3mg - Astaxanthin 50ug - Sorbitol 26mg

Warnings

PHYTOPURE KRILL OIL is sourced from crustacean shellfish. Individuals with known shellfish hypersensitivity should not take PHYTOPURE KRILL OIL. Hypersensitivity has been known to occur with shellfish and should it develop, use should be discontinued. High doses of DHA and EPA might decrease coagulation and increase the risk of bleeding due to antiplatelet effects. Advise users with a bleeding disorder or those taking anticoagulants or antiplatelet medicines to consult a healthcare provider prior to use. They must also adhere to the recommended maximum daily dosage of two capsules. Due to the possible anticoagulant effects, patients scheduled for elective surgery should discontinue PHYTOPURE KRILL OIL two weeks before such surgical procedures. Interaction with medicines ANTICOAGULANTS/ANTIPLATELET MEDICATION- PHYTOPURE KRILL OIL in combination with anticoagulants and/or antiplatelet medicines may increase the risk of bleeding. Advise patients who are using anticoagulants or antiplatelet agents to strictly adhere to the dosage instructions. Such patients should stop taking PHYTOPURE KRILL OIL if they develop bruising, nose bleeds, excessive bleeding from minor injuries, or bleeding from the gums and report to their healthcare provider ANTIDIABETIC MEDICINES PHYTOPURE KRILL OIL in combination with antidiabetic medicines may increase the risk of hypoglycaemia. Patients taking antidiabetic medicines should carefully monitor blood glucose levels when supplementation with PHYTOPURE KRILL OIL is initiated or discontinued. It may be necessary to adjust the dosage of their antidiabetic medication. Interaction with herbs and supplements HERBS AND SUPPLEMENTS WITH ANTICOAGULANT/ANTIPLATELET PROPERTIES PHYTOPURE KRILL OIL should be used with caution in combination with herbs and supplements that may have anticoagulant properties in medicinal amounts due to a possible increased risk of bleeding. Advise patients who are using anticoagulants or antiplatelet agents to strictly adhere to the dosage instructions. Examples of such herbs and supplements include angelica, clove, danshen, garlic, ginger, ginkgo, and Panax ginseng. HERBS AND SUPPLEMENTS WITH HYPOGLYCAEMIC POTENTIAL Caution is required when PHYTOPURE KRILL OIL is combined with herbs or supplements with hypoglycaemic potential due to possible additive effects. Examples of such herbs and supplements include alpha-lipoic acid, berberine, bitter melon, chromium, fenugreek, garlic, ginger, horsetail, Panax ginseng, and many others. Avoid using PHYTOPURE KRILL OIL during pregnancy and lactation.
